Gradman, Harry L.; Hanania, Edith – Modern Language Journal, 1991
A study investigated which of many possible variables in the student's language learning background (formal learning, exposure and use in class, extracurricular exposure and use, attitudes and motivation) were important in second-language learning. Subjects were 101 students in intensive English-as-a-Second-Language (ESL). Several success factors…
